Archbishop Viganò leads launch rosary for 54-day US election novena
The 54-day rosary novena is made up of six successive traditional rosary novenas consisting of nine days each. The first three novenas are a petition for our request, and the latter three thank God for answering our prayer. Hosted on Acast. See acast.com/privacy for more information.
